1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134 135 136 137 138 139 140 141 142 143 144 145 146 147 148 149 150 151 152 153 154 155 156 157 158 159 160 161 162 163 164 165 166 167 168 169 170 171 172 173 174 175 176 177 178 179 180 181 182 183 184 185 186 187 188 189 190 191 192 193 194 195 196 197 198 199 200 201 202 203 204 205 206
|
% \iffalse meta-comment
%% File: jltxdoc.dtx
%
% Copyright 1995,1996,1997 ASCII Corporation.
% Copyright (c) 2010 ASCII MEDIA WORKS
% Copyright (c) 2016-2022 Japanese TeX Development Community
%
% This file is part of the pLaTeX2e system (community edition).
% -------------------------------------------------------------
%
% \fi
%
%
% \setcounter{StandardModuleDepth}{1}
% \StopEventually{}
%
% \iffalse
% \changes{v1.0a}{1997/01/23}{\LaTeX \texttt{!<1996/12/01!>}$B$X$NBP1~$K(B
% $B9g$o$;$F=$@5(B}
% \changes{v1.0b}{1997/07/29}{\cs{}$B$H(B\texttt{"}$B$N(B\cs{xspcode}$B$rJQ99(B}
% \changes{v1.0c}{2016/07/25}{doc$B%Q%C%1!<%8$,>e=q$-$9$k(B\cs{verb}$B$r:F!9Dj5A(B}
% \changes{v1.0d}{2017/09/24}{\cs{vadjust\{\}}$B$rDI2C(B}
% \fi
%
% \iffalse
%<class>\NeedsTeXFormat{pLaTeX2e}
%<class>\ProvidesClass{jltxdoc}[2017/09/24 v1.0d Standard pLaTeX file]
%<*driver>
\RequirePackage{plautopatch}
\documentclass[dvipdfmx,a4paper]{jltxdoc}
\GetFileInfo{jltxdoc.cls}
\title{p\LaTeXe{}$B%I%-%e%a%s%H5-=RMQ%/%i%9(B\space\fileversion}
\author{Ken Nakano}
\date{$B:n@.F|!'(B\filedate}
\begin{document}
\maketitle
\DocInput{jltxdoc.dtx}
\end{document}
%</driver>
% \fi
%
% \file{jltxdoc}$B%/%i%9$O!"(B\file{ltxdoc}$B$r%F%s%W%l!<%H$K$7$F!"F|K\8lMQ$N(B
% $B=$@5$r2C$($F$$$^$9!#(B
% \begin{macrocode}
%<*class>
\DeclareOption*{\PassOptionsToClass{\CurrentOption}{ltxdoc}}
\ProcessOptions
\LoadClass{ltxdoc}
% \end{macrocode}
%
% \begin{macro}{\normalsize}
% \begin{macro}{\small}
% \begin{macro}{\parindent}
% \changes{v1.0a}{1997/01/23}{\cs{normalsize}, \cs{small}$B$J$I$N:FDj5A(B}
% \file{ltxdoc}$B$+$i%m!<%I$5$l$k(B\file{article}$B%/%i%9$G$N9T4V$J$I$N@_DjCM$G!"(B
% $BF|K\8l$NJ8>O$rAHHG$9$k$H!"9T4V$,69$$$h$&$K;W$o$l$k$N$G!"B?>/9-$/$9$k$h$&$K(B
% $B:F@_Dj$7$^$9!#$^$?!"CJMn@hF,$G$N;z2<$2NL$rA43Q0lJ8;zJ,$H$7$^$9!#(B
% \begin{macrocode}
\renewcommand{\normalsize}{%
\@setfontsize\normalsize\@xpt{15}%
\abovedisplayskip 10\p@ \@plus2\p@ \@minus5\p@
\abovedisplayshortskip \z@ \@plus3\p@
\belowdisplayshortskip 6\p@ \@plus3\p@ \@minus3\p@
\belowdisplayskip \abovedisplayskip
\let\@listi\@listI}
\renewcommand{\small}{%
\@setfontsize\small\@ixpt{11}%
\abovedisplayskip 8.5\p@ \@plus3\p@ \@minus4\p@
\abovedisplayshortskip \z@ \@plus2\p@
\belowdisplayshortskip 4\p@ \@plus2\p@ \@minus2\p@
\def\@listi{\leftmargin\leftmargini
\topsep 4\p@ \@plus2\p@ \@minus2\p@
\parsep 2\p@ \@plus\p@ \@minus\p@
\itemsep \parsep}%
\belowdisplayskip \abovedisplayskip}
\normalsize
\setlength\parindent{1zw}
% \end{macrocode}
% \end{macro}
% \end{macro}
% \end{macro}
%
% \begin{macro}{\file}
% |\file|$B%^%/%m$O!"%U%!%$%kL>$r<($9$N$KMQ$$$^$9!#(B
% \begin{macrocode}
\providecommand*{\file}[1]{\texttt{#1}}
% \end{macrocode}
% \end{macro}
%
% \begin{macro}{\pstyle}
% |\pstyle|$B%^%/%m$O!"%Z!<%8%9%?%$%kL>$r<($9$N$KMQ$$$^$9!#(B
% \begin{macrocode}
\providecommand*{\pstyle}[1]{\textsl{#1}}
% \end{macrocode}
% \end{macro}
%
% \begin{macro}{\Lcount}
% |\Lcount|$B%^%/%m$O!"%+%&%s%?L>$r<($9$N$KMQ$$$^$9!#(B
% \begin{macrocode}
\providecommand*{\Lcount}[1]{\textsl{\small#1}}
% \end{macrocode}
% \end{macro}
%
% \begin{macro}{\Lopt}
% |\Lopt|$B%^%/%m$O!"%/%i%9%*%W%7%g%s$d%Q%C%1!<%8%*%W%7%g%s$r<($9$N$KMQ$$$^$9!#(B
% \begin{macrocode}
\providecommand*{\Lopt}[1]{\textsf{#1}}
% \end{macrocode}
% \end{macro}
%
% \begin{macro}{\dst}
% |\dst|$B%^%/%m$O!"(B``\dst''$B$r=PNO$9$k!#(B
% \begin{macrocode}
\providecommand\dst{{\normalfont\scshape docstrip}}
% \end{macrocode}
% \end{macro}
%
% \begin{macro}{\NFSS}
% |\NFSS|$B%^%/%m$O!"(B``\NFSS''$B$r=PNO$7$^$9!#(B
% \begin{macrocode}
\providecommand\NFSS{\textsf{NFSS}}
% \end{macrocode}
% \end{macro}
%
% \begin{macro}{\c@clineno}
% \begin{macro}{\mlineplus}
% |\mlineplus|$B%^%/%m$O!"$=$N;~E@$G$N%^%/%m%3!<%I$N9THV9f$K!"0z?t$K;XDj$5$l$?(B
% $B9T?t$@$1$r2C$($??tCM$r=PNO$7$^$9!#$?$H$($P(B|\mlineplus{3}|$B$H$9$l$P!"(B
% $BD>A0$N%^%/%m%3!<%I$N9THV9f(B(\arabic{CodelineNo})$B$K(B3$B$r2C$($??t!"(B
% ``\mlineplus{3}''$B$,=PNO$5$l$^$9!#(B
% \begin{macrocode}
\newcounter{@clineno}
\def\mlineplus#1{\setcounter{@clineno}{\arabic{CodelineNo}}%
\addtocounter{@clineno}{#1}\arabic{@clineno}}
% \end{macrocode}
% \end{macro}
% \end{macro}
%
% \begin{environment}{tsample}
% |tsample|$B4D6-$O!"4D6-Fb$K;XDj$5$l$?FbMF$r7S@~$G0O$C$F=PNO$r$7$^$9!#(B
% $BBh0l0z?t$O!"=PNO$9$k%\%C%/%9$N9b$5$G$9!#(B
% \file{plext.dtx}$B$NCf$G;HMQ$7$F$$$^$9!#(B
% $B$3$N%^%/%mFb$G$O=DAH$K$J$k$3$H$KCm0U$7$F$/$@$5$$!#(B
% \begin{macrocode}
\def\tsample#1{%
\hbox to\linewidth\bgroup\vrule width.1pt\hss
\vbox\bgroup\hrule height.1pt
\vskip.5\baselineskip
\vbox to\linewidth\bgroup\tate\hsize=#1\relax\vss}
\def\endtsample{%
\vss\egroup
\vskip.5\baselineskip
\hrule height.1pt\egroup
\hss\vrule width.1pt\egroup}
% \end{macrocode}
% \end{environment}
%
% \begin{macro}{\DisableCrossrefs}
% \begin{macro}{\EnableCrossrefs}
% \file{jclasses.dtx}$B$r=hM}$9$k$H$-$K!"(B|\if$B@>Nq(B|$B$NItJ,$G%(%i!<$K$J$k$?$a!"(B
% $B0l;~E*$K%/%m%9%j%U%!%l%s%9$N5!G=$r%*%U$K$7$^$9!#(B
% $B$7$+$7!"%G%U%)%k%H$NDj5A$G$O40A4$K@)8f$G$-$J$$$N$G!"$3$3$G:FDj5A$r$7$^$9!#(B
% \begin{macrocode}
\def\DisableCrossrefs{\@bsphack\scan@allowedfalse\@esphack}
\def\EnableCrossrefs{\@bsphack\scan@allowedtrue
\def\DisableCrossrefs{\@bsphack\scan@allowedfalse\@esphack}\@esphack}
% \end{macrocode}
% \end{macro}
% \end{macro}
%
% \begin{macro}{\verb}
% p\LaTeX{}$B$G$O!"(B|\verb|$B%3%^%s%I$r=$@5$7$FD>A0$K(B|\xkanjiskip|$B$,F~$k$h$&$K(B
% $B$7$F$$$^$9!#$7$+$7!"(B\file{ltxdoc.cls}$B$,FI$_9~$`(B\file{doc.sty}$B$,>e=q$-(B
% $B$7$F$7$^$$$^$9$N$G!"$3$l$r:F!9Dj5A$7$^$9!#(B\file{doc.sty}$B$G$NDj5A$O(B
%\begin{verbatim}
% \def\verb{\relax\ifmmode\hbox\else\leavevmode\null\fi
% \bgroup \let\do\do@noligs \verbatim@nolig@list
% \ttfamily \verb@eol@error \let\do\@makeother \dospecials
% \@ifstar{\@sverb}{\@vobeyspaces \frenchspacing \@sverb}}
%\end{verbatim}
% $B$H$J$C$F$$$^$9$N$G!"(B\file{plcore.dtx}$B$HF1MM$K(B|\null|$B$r30$7$F(B|\vadjust{}|$B$r(B
% $BF~$l$^$9!#(B
% \changes{v1.0c}{2016/07/25}{doc$B%Q%C%1!<%8$,>e=q$-$9$k(B\cs{verb}$B$r:F!9Dj5A(B}
% \changes{v1.0d}{2017/09/24}{\cs{vadjust\{\}}$B$rDI2C(B}
% \begin{macrocode}
\def\verb{\relax\ifmmode\hbox\else\leavevmode\vadjust{}\fi
\bgroup \let\do\do@noligs \verbatim@nolig@list
\ttfamily \verb@eol@error \let\do\@makeother \dospecials
\@ifstar{\@sverb}{\@vobeyspaces \frenchspacing \@sverb}}
% \end{macrocode}
% \end{macro}
%
% \begin{macro}{\xspcode}
% $B%3%^%s%IL>$N(B|\|$B$H(B16$B?J?t$r<($9$?$a$N(B|"|$B$NA0$K$b%9%Z!<%9$,F~$k$h$&!"(B
% $B$3$l$i$N(B|\xspcode|$B$NCM$rJQ99$7$^$9!#(B
% \changes{v1.0b}{1997/07/29}{\cs{}$B$H(B\texttt{"}$B$N(B\cs{xspcode}$B$rJQ99(B}
% \begin{macrocode}
\xspcode"5C=3 %% \
\xspcode"22=3 %% "
%</class>
% \end{macrocode}
% \end{macro}
%
% \Finale
%
\endinput
|